About the role

Under the general direction of the Systems Director Pharmacy, is responsible for all aspects of dispensing, compounding, labeling, storage, patient and staff education, and proper usage of pharmaceutical preparations. Verifies physician orders or provides entry of prescription orders into the electronic medical record. Provides Clinical Pharmacy services per established protocol and policies. Collaborates and contributes to patient’s care plan with documented interventions and notes. Coordinates safe transition of care to or from the hospital with patient, caregivers, other institutions, providers and Pharmacies. Maintains appropriate patient record documentation for clinical and distributive services provided. Adheres to best practices for medication safety that promote safe and effective use of medication within the Organization. Monitors the patients’ drug therapy to ensure that each medication ordered is safe and appropriate for the patient. Responds to clinical codes or emergencies. Responsible for supervision, training and inspection of all work performed by Technicians and Students. Precepts Students or Residents. Exhibits the F.I.R.S.T. values (Friendliness, Innovation, Respect, Service, and Trust).

The Advanced Clinical Pharmacist has demonstrated advanced clinical skills or knowledge through formal education and Board Certification. Specialty Certifications or peer based organization service and recognition for expanded scope of practice is required for some advanced clinical services. The Advanced Clinical Pharmacist has demonstrated proficiency in all clinical assignments and routinely takes clinical assignments involving complex patients or where an advanced credential or certification is required for practice(ED, ICU, CSC, ASP, AC or HF clinics). 

The Advanced Clinical Pharmacist shares and contributes to the body of knowledge through

  • Research: as a primary investigator, author of manuscript, residency research preceptor, active member of Research Council, peer reviewer for research presentation or manuscript or formal research mentor
  • Educator: speaker/poster presenter at a professional conference, staff in-service or CE program, skills fair module, simulated clinical experiences (mock)training events, modeling, coaching and facilitating learning of residents and/or APPE students through didactic presentations or 1:1 topic discussions. Serves as clinical educator for pharmacists or clinical staff, trains and orients new pharmacists and residents, providing feedback, performance evaluations and determining competency.
  • Clinical Effectiveness/Performance Improvement: performance improvement data collection, analysis and reporting, including leading changes to impact outcomes and quality, medication use evaluations, pharmacy clinical or operational roundtable participation, change management projects, sentinel event alert action plans and gap analysis, serves as pharmacy representative on multi-disciplinary teams or medical staff committees to facilitate evidence based practice initiatives, order sets, quality metrics and best practice advocates.
